Staffing Guidelines. The Employer will use the guideline provided herein to determine the appropriate staffing levels of Banquet/Beverage staff. These guidelines may be adjusted up or down for the purposes of addressing the specific needs of MTCC’s customers and/or the service requirements of the event and in keeping with the Employer’s goal to manage labour costs. (2010) F2.01 Wait staff are assigned 40 anticipated covers per pair of Employees. F2.02 Wait staff are assigned to receptions on the basis of one wait staff per 75 anticipated guests.
